A Quick Overview of "Blue Bloods"
Before we dive into the nitty-gritty of death on "Blue Bloods," let’s take a moment to refresh our memories about the show. "Blue Bloods" follows the Reagan family, a multigenerational clan of cops in New York City. From Frank Reagan, the commissioner of the NYPD, to his son Danny, a detective, and daughter Erin, an ADA, each character brings their own unique perspective to the table.
The show has been running for over a decade, and in that time, it’s tackled some pretty heavy topics, including corruption, political scandals, and, of course, death. But what makes "Blue Bloods" special is its ability to balance these serious themes with moments of humor and heartwarming family interactions.
